Professor Panos Vostanis

Biography

Professor Vostanis has published extensively on the impact of trauma on child mental health, evaluation of interventions and services for traumatized children, including those living in conflict settings. Other research includes school mental health and service evaluation. He founded the World Awareness for Children in Trauma programme (www.wacit.org) to develop evidence-based psychosocial interventions and capacity building for vulnerable children and young people. To this effect, he is involved in several projects with NGOs and academic centres in Asia, Africa and Latin America, especially on service improvement. Professor Vostanis has longstanding clinical experience as a child psychiatrist with vulnerable children, young people and families, i.e. in care, homeless, adopted, refugees, young offenders, or living in disadvantage.
